Betamethasone Dipropionate Lotion USP, 0.05% is a medication used for dermatological purposes only. The lotion contains Betamethasone Dipropionate and other ingredients such as carbomer homopolymer type B, isopropyl alcohol, purified water, and sodium hydroxide. It is advised to apply the lotion onto the affected areas of the skin twice a day, in the morning and night until it disappears. The medication should be stored at 20-25°C and protected from light and freezing. The lotion is distributed by Perrigo in Allegan, MI 49010, and the net contents of the lotion bottle are 60 mL. Shake well before using. For more details, refer to the package insert and accompanying directions.*
